



Flanged industrial immersion heaters are commonly used in many chemical, petroleum and water based applications. Consisting normally of an ANSI rated flange with several hairpin elements or bugle tubular elements extending from the face of the flange, this flanged immersion heater uses direct heat application to the liquid medium. A thermowell is often used within the bundle of tubular elements to allow for a probe (either a thermocouple, RTD or basic mechanical thermostat) to relay temperature readings to a digital controller that cycles and maintains the desired target temperature. Often a high limit sensor is also used to help protect liquid mediums from over heating and, offers protection to the flanged heater as well.

Wattco flanged immersion heaters allow the flexibility of using many different alloys to help resist corrosion and maintain life longevity of the flanged heater. Steel flanged immersion heaters are typically used for lubricant oils, heavy and light oils, waxes as well as mildly corrosive liquids and low flow gas heating. Process water, soap and detergent solutions as well as demineralised or deionised water applications often use steel flanges. Stainless steel flanged heating elements are used with mildly corrosive solutions as well as severe corrosive solutions. Food applications also use stainless steel for sanitary purposes. The sheath materials used can be steel, stainless steel, copper as well as exotic alloys such as inconel, hastalloy and titanium. Extremely corrosive environments such as salt water should use exotic alloys such as titanium to avoid sheath breach over excessive durations. Industries that use exotic alloys can include military, chemical and process industries.
Flanged immersion heaters allow for immediate heat transfer into your liquid medium that is more efficient than most alternative methods of heating. Flanged immersion heaters also adhere to environmental concerns as electric heating leaves no carbon footprint in the ecology. Many applications use flanged immersion heaters as the sole method of heating or, use it in conjunction with existing heating alternatives that allow users to reach target temperatures. Flanged immersion heaters come with 150LBS, 300LBS, 600 LBS or custom made flanges if required. These flanged heaters also come with baffles for sturdy construction, as well as the option to maintain close temperature readings by attaching thermocouples onto sheath of the tubular elements. Digital controllers and hi limit controlers would then be used to maintain proper temperatures and protect the flanged immersion heater from overheating.

LENGTH |
WATTCO™ flange heaters are supplied with unlimited immersed lengths. When the immersed length exceeds 50”, it is recommended to install an internal vessel support. |
|
EXTRA HEAVY WALL SHEATH |
Heavy wall sheath (0.049” or 0.065” thickness) is provided in: • Incoloy® • Inconel® • Steel • Stainless steel |

PASSIVATION |
Available Incoloy® and stainless steel sheathed heaters are supplied with chemically passivated flanged immersion heater sheaths. Note: Chemically passivated sheaths are highly corrosion resistant in most applications. Passivation process is carried out through electropolishing. WELDED ELEMENTS |
WATTCO™ standard flange heaters are made of elements that are silver-brazed, ‘TIG’ or welded to the flange. Heaters are supplied with welded elements for the following sheath material: • Incoloy® • Stainless steel • Steel • Copper

VENTED or STAND OFF |
Vented or Stand off housings prevent the connection wire from overheating in many high temperature applications. |
